General Motors Facility in Massena, N.Y., to Upgrade Robot Software.

Knight Ridder/Tribune Business News, April, 2004

By Itai M. Maytal, Watertown Daily Times, N.Y. Knight Ridder/Tribune Business News

Apr. 10--MASSENA, N.Y. -- General Motors Powertrain will install by June three more "vision" software packages that will help its robots better position items on assembly lines.

Engine parts at the plant are sometimes tilted 10 degrees or placed several inches out of alignment when loaded by robots onto a conveyor belt. When this happens, other robots crash into the parts, generating costly downtime and expensive scrap.
